Abstract
249,497. Soc. of Chemical Industry in Basle. March 19, 1925, [Convention date]. Quinolinic anhydride is prepared by heating quinolinic acid with acetic anhydride at a temperature below 100‹ C. A catalyst, such as pyridine, hydrochloric acid, sulphuric acid, acetyl chloride, a phosphorus halide or an acid salt, may be present. Examples are given.
